Plans For Wrexham and Flintshire CCTV Operation
Plans to develop a CCTV scheme between Wrexham and Flintshire were discussed at the Customers, Performance and Resources Scrutiny Committee yesterday.
If the scheme is successful, it would appear that a joint CCTV operating system between the two counties could be based at either the People’s Market in Wrexham or at Redwither Tower on the Wrexham Industrial Estate.
CCTV monitoring in North Wales currently takes place through six separate operations, with one in each local authority area. However at the Regional Leadership Board meeting on 1 February 2013, a consensus was reached to proceed with a regional operation using two centres.
This decision to use a joint two-tier system was backed by the Executive Board in March.
Cllr Hugh Jones, lead member for communications, partnerships and collaborations said in the meeting that the Council are working in partnership with Flintshire to develop a joint CCTV operating system. He said: “We are looking at a number of options. Option one is a Wrexham only based option based in the existing location in the People’s Market.
“The second option is a Wrexham and Flintshire one based at the People’s Market.
“The third option is a Wrexham only one at Redwither Tower and option four is a Wrexham and Flintshire one at Redwither Tower.”
It is believed that savings of £50,000 to £80,000 in operational costs could be made by moving to Redwither Tower.
